The heart of a good silicone glass lid isn't the glass or the silicone alone—it's the interface. The bonding process is where many factories cut corners. A proper high-temperature vulcanization bonding, using food-grade adhesive, is non-negotiable for durability. I recall visiting facilities where they were still using a simpler room-temperature vulcanization for some lines because it was faster, but the bond would degrade under repeated steam exposure. You have to ask specifically about their bonding method. A manufacturer worth its salt will have a dedicated, climate-controlled area for this process, not just a corner of the assembly line.
Then there's the glass itself. Tempered is standard, but the quality of the tempering oven and the annealing process dictates the failure rate. A lid that explodes in a sink from minor thermal stress is a liability. I've had samples from seemingly reputable vendors that showed stress patterns under a polariscope, indicating poor tempering. This is why visiting the production base, like the one EUR-ASIA COOKWARE operates in Taian, Shandong, matters. Seeing their capacity—an annual output of over 15 million pieces of tempered glass—tells you about scale, but you need to scrutinize their quality control checkpoint for glass integrity before it even moves to the silicone station.
The silicone compound is another black box. Food-grade silicone is a baseline, but the specific polymer blend affects hardness (shore hardness), stain resistance, and colorfastness. A manufacturer that develops its own compounds or works closely with a reputable compounder has more control. The cheap, overly soft silicone that deforms and won't snap back? That often comes from buying the lowest-cost generic material on the market. For long-term partnerships, you need transparency on the silicone source.
Most buyers searching for a silicone glass lid manufacturer are targeting export markets. This immediately narrows the field. A factory's export history is its resume. When you look at a company like EUR-ASIA COOKWARE CO.,LTD., with over 90% of products exported to Germany, France, Japan, and others, it signals an ingrained understanding of compliance—not just CE or FDA, but the specific retailer standards from chains like Lidl or Carrefour which can be more stringent than regulatory ones. They've likely navigated the nightmare of SVHC (Substance of Very High Concern) declarations under REACH for the EU market.
This export focus shapes the entire operation. Packaging, for instance. I've spent hours with logistics managers arguing about carton drop tests and palletization to prevent breakage during long sea voyages. A manufacturer experienced in exports will have optimized this. They'll also understand the importance of documentation—detailed packing lists, test reports on demand, and smooth communication for letters of credit. The difference between a smooth shipment and a stuck container often lies in these details.
However, a high export percentage doesn't automatically mean perfection for your project. Their main lines might be optimized for high-volume, standard items. If you need a custom diameter, an unusual silicone color, or a specific embossed logo, you're now testing their flexibility. This is where smaller runs can become problematic. You need to gauge their willingness and capability for custom tooling—the mold for the silicone gasket is a cost driver—and their MOQs. It's a negotiation between their efficiency and your requirements.

In my experience, the key departments to assess are: 1) The glass cutting and tempering workshop (is it automated cutting or manual? How many tempering ovens?), 2) The silicone molding and bonding area (how many presses? Is the bonding done in a clean environment?), and 3) The final assembly and QC station. Are they doing 100% leak testing or just spot checks? Do they have a dedicated lab for basic material checks?
The workforce composition is a subtle indicator. A stable, skilled workforce in a specialized zone like Taian's High-tech Development Zone often means better consistency. High employee turnover in assembly lines can lead to quality fluctuations. During visits, I always try to get a sense of morale and training. Are the workers on the bonding line following a clear SOP, or is it haphazard?
Another practical point is their upstream integration. Do they source cut glass from another local supplier, or do they control the process from the glass sheet? Do they mold their own silicone components? More control usually means better cost management and reliability in raw material shortages, but it also means higher fixed costs for them. For a buyer, a more vertically integrated manufacturer like EUR-ASIA, which specializes in household glass products, can offer more stability for long-term projects, as they're less vulnerable to supply chain hiccups in the glass or component market.
One of the biggest pitfalls is not defining quality upfront. Is it purely about safety and function, or does it include cosmetic perfection? For glass, the acceptable level of inclusions (tiny bubbles) or minimal edge grinding marks needs to be agreed upon with samples and approved limits. I once had a shipment held up because the buyer's QC insisted on optical clarity rivaling drinking glasses, which is an unrealistic and costly standard for a pot lid. The lesson: align on AQL (Acceptable Quality Level) standards for critical, major, and minor defects before production begins.
Communication breakdowns are endemic. The term silicone glass lid can mean different things: a full glass lid with a silicone rim, a glass lid with a stainless steel rim and silicone seal, or a glass insert within a silicone frame. Detailed technical drawings, 3D files, and signed-off physical prototypes are the only way to prevent costly mistakes. Assume nothing.
Finally, the failure of set and forget. Even with a reliable manufacturer in China, periodic audits and unannounced inspections during production runs are wise. Conditions change, management shifts, cost pressures mount. Maintaining a relationship and showing you are an engaged, professional partner encourages them to maintain your standards. It's not about mistrust; it's about shared responsibility for the product.
The conversation is slowly shifting. European importers are starting to ask about carbon footprint, recyclability of the materials, and sustainable packaging. A forward-thinking manufacturer will have answers or at least be exploring them. Can the silicone be separated from the glass for recycling? Is the packaging made from recycled cardboard? These aren't mainstream demands yet, but they're on the horizon and could become a differentiator.
Customization is also moving beyond logos and colors. We're seeing requests for integrated steam vents, locking mechanisms compatible with specific cookware lines, and even silicone handles with ergonomic designs. This pushes the manufacturer from being a pure OEM to a design and development partner. It requires a different level of engineering capability and willingness to invest in R&D.
